概括
多普勒超声波显示了婴儿败血性部显著的血管变化. 这些多普勒参数有助于诊断败血性关节炎,使婴儿的感染与健康的部区分开来.

背景情况:
- 关节的败血性关节炎是婴儿的关键状况.
- 早期和准确的诊断对于预防长期关节损伤至关重要.
- 多普勒超声波提供了一种非侵入性的方法来评估血液流动.
研究的目的:
- 用多普勒超声学量化评估婴儿急性败血性部血管性的变化.
- 将这些发现与无症状的部进行比较.
- 为了建立准确诊断的相关性.
主要方法:
- 未来病例控制研究,包括患有败血性关节炎的1岁以下婴儿.
- 对照组是没有部病理的健康婴儿.
- 中部大腿环动脉的多普勒超声波测量了峰值缩速度 (PSV),电阻指数 (RI),脉动率指数 (PI) 和缩与透缩比 (SD比).
主要成果:
- 多普勒信号在败血症和对照组中100%的部都能得到.
- 在和对照部之间观察到PSV,RI,PI和SD比率的统计学上显著差异.
- 与对照部 (6.18) 相比,败血性部 (11.8) 的平均PSV显著更高.
结论:
- 多普勒超声波的参数对于怀疑败血性关节炎是有价值的.
- 年龄/性别和多普勒参数之间没有发现显著的相关性.
- 确定的基线值适用于7个月以下的儿童.

Ultrasonography is an imaging technique that uses high-frequency sound waves to visualize the body's internal structures. It is a non-invasive and safe procedure that does not involve the use of ionizing radiation, making it widely used in various medical fields. Ultrasonography is used to study heart function, blood flow in the neck or extremities, certain conditions such as gallbladder disease, and fetal growth and development.
